With Cadogan's "Working & Living: Australia, " the move to this striking country will go as smoothly as possible. Everything readers need to know about living and working in Australia is covered in this invaluable guide, from gaining visas and work permits to Internet services available. Detailed advice helps them put their dream of moving to Australia into practice, with details on how to buy a house, get a job, and find schools. Case studies of people who have already made the move Down Under are dotted throughout the text, giving them a personal insight into how life will change, and fascinating facts about Australia provide small, quirky snapshots of this spectacular country.

Uncovers the best places for you to move to, from Sydney to Perth * gives specialist advice on dealing with all the red tape, from gaining visas and work permits to buying a property and moving in * guides you through the settling in process, from education and healthcare to cellular phone services and banking * puts Australia into context with details on its political, economic and religious situation, and social behaviour * helps with the challenges of finding a job, both working for other people and setting up your own business Jane Egginton is an award-winning travel writer and photographer who has lived and worked in Australia and travelled extensively around the world writing for a wide range of publishers including Thomas Cook, Berlitz and the AA

(1) Introduction; (2) Getting to Know Australia; (3) Profiles of the Regions; (4) Australia Today; (5) First Steps; (6) Red Tape; (7) Living in Australia; (8) Working in Australia; (9) References.
